Joomla Interview Questions & Answers – 2

51. What is the difference between Drupal and Joomla?Explain Joomla Drupal
1. Joomla is easy to control and suitable to handle midrange projects. Drupal is one of the hardest CMS to control and suitable for complex projects.
2. Less powerful tools compared to Drupal Drupal offers powerful tools, but they are hard to master.
3. Suitable for projects looking for an intuitive interface and standardized capabilities. Suitable for projects looking for scalability and versatility.
4. Highly accessible, flexible and designer-friendly Requires high amount of learning curves

52. What is the difference between WordPress and Joomla?Explain Joomla WordPress
1. Excellent search engine optimization capability Has search engine optimization capability but less compared to Joomla
2. More secure compared to WordPress due to its own set of security extensions Security vulnerability
3. Less customization potential the sheer number of customization potential
4. Requires less amount of training Simpler content management

53. What are the Similarities Between Joomla and WordPress?
• Both Joomla and WordPress are written in PHP.
• Joomla and WordPress are open source and are free.

54. What is the language manager in Joomla?
In Joomla, the language manager option is used to set the Native Title, SEF Prefix, Image Prefixes and Language Code of the installed or to be installed language.

55. How to update my Joomla website?
• Backup your Joomla website
• Now login to the server hosting the Joomla through ssh
• Go to the folder /home/[cpanel-username/public_html
• Download the latest version of Joomla to the server
• Extract the downloaded file onto Joomla website
• Remove the installation folder
• Remove the downloaded Joomla install
• Now your website is fully updated to the latest version

56. How to take backup of my Joomla website?
To take a complete backup of your Joomla website:
• Take database backup at first
• Log in to Hosting control panel and select File manager
• Now locate the root folder for the Joomla website
• Search for the file configuration.php
• Open it and check database name, username, and password
• Go to cPanel, open ‘phpMyAdmin,‘ select the database name and export and save the .sql file in the computer
• Go to the File Manager present in cPanel, choose to select all
• Download and save it as a .zip file in your computer
• The backup process is complete now

57. Lists the templates used in Joomla?
We can use two types of templates in Joomla:-
• Front-end templates: It changes the website look to average users.
• Back-end templates: It changes the administrator look and rare to find.

58. Name the Joomla templates.
Joomla templates:
o Beez3
o Hathor
o Isis
o Protostar

59. Which editor is used in Joomla?
TinyMCE Editor

60. Why Do The Pop Ups In My Wysiwyg Editor Not Work Or Show Gibberish?
Depending on the editor, this problem may occur when trying to edit the html, insert tables or perform a similar function that requires javascript.
Most likely the problem with the livesite.
You look in your site configuration (General Configuration, select the Server tab) you will see that the livesite is given. Usually it is either or
When you log into your site, you must log in from the exact livesite. if you don’t the javascript in your editor will not work.
One way to deal with this is to put a redirect from, for example, to so that you and your users always login from the correct url. You can do this with .htaccess.

61. Which are the Editor buttons in TinyMCE Editor?
The Editor buttons are:
• Article
• Image
• Page Break
• Read More
• Toggle Editor.

62. What is the use of Read More button in TinyMCE editor?
The red dotted line gets displayed in the editor. The further information part of the article gets displayed after the read dotted lines or sometimes it displays the entire article.

63. What is article Metadata?
Metadata describes details of the article in short. It makes easy to work with the particular data.

64. What does the Purchase Type column indicates in Banner Manager?
It indicates how the clients are purchasing the banners i.e. yearly or Monthly. By default it is monthly.

65. What is Template Manager?
It manages the various templates that are used in the website. The templates can be used without changing the content structure of the website.

66. What is the use of <jdoc:include type=”modules” name=”top” /> in index.php while creating templates?
In body section the jdoc is used to include the output in Joomla from some parts of Joomla system. The name=”top” is used to set the menu at the top.

67. What is Category Manager?
Category Manager is used to create categories for the article which allow grouping your content better.

68. How we can change the images for template in Joomla?
To change the images for the template in Joomla, we have to access the back-end administrative interface navigates to Extensions and then select Template Manager. Now select the template which needs to be modified and click edit. Then click on the icon to access Edit HTML.
Additional information: The images for a given template are generally located in this folder: /templates /templatename /images (Substitute the name of the template you are using in place of “templatename”).
A trick for finding the name of the image is to put your cursor over it and click right. Select view image. This will display the image and give its full url. Sometimes the images are background images. This is viewable in Firefox or you can look for the background tag in your page source.
How to upload an image: There are many ways to upload images. Which one you use will depend on your host and server.
1. You can use an ftp client.
2. You can use a cpanel file manager.
3. You can use the media manager.
4. You can use various extensions that allow uploading, including joomlaexplorer and galleries.

69. What Are Pathways Or Breadcrumbs?
If you are on a particular page and to get to that page you had to go through several folders to find that particular page, then that series of links will be your pathway or breadcrumb. For example: Home >> Books >> Pages >> New Page.

70. Explain Breadcrumb Module in Joomla?
Breadcrumb displays hierarchical representation with click able links for the users to determine where they are in the web site and allow them to navigate back.

71. How Do I Eliminate The Pathway Or Breadcrumbs?
In this case the breadcrumb for that page would look like: “Home >> Books >> Pages >> New Page”.
If you wish to eliminate the pathway entirely, edit your template html (index) file. Usually it will look like this:

<div id="pathway">
<?php mospathway(): ?>

If you wish to eliminate it on a specific page, such as just the home page, you can modify the template in this way:

New line:if($option != "" && $option != "com_frontpage")
New line:{
New line:?>
New line:}
New line:?>

Understanding: The first line says that if the option in the url does not equal com_frontpage (!=”com_frontpage”) display the pathway. In php ! means not.

72. How To Control The Contents Of The Newsflashes?
In the newsflash, one can display any content in specific sections.
o In the administrative back end of top menu select “modules”>>”site modules”
o To edit the module, click on “newsflash”.
o Beside the “Category” parameter, click on the drop down menu and select the category of the content that should be displayed on the page.
o Click on “Save” to save your changes.

73. How we can configure a Joomla site to use HTTPS? Explain
Joomla has a feature named as Joomla Force SSL to activate the SSL Certificate and use HTTPS.
• First, install an SSL certificate in your server
• Get the dedicated IP Address unique for one SSL Certificate to
• configure the configuration.php file
• Find the

var $live_site ='';
and replace it with
var $live_site = ';

• open .htaccess file and add

RewriteEngine On
RewriteCond %{HTTPS} OFF
R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I}

• Now enable force SSL
• Apply and Save

74. How to configure mail function in Joomla?
There are chances that Joomla will be set up by default to use the PHP mail function. If not, the setting can be modified by accessing the Joomla admin area. Go to section, access Global Configuration and then Server. The corresponding parameters can be found under the “Mail Settings” section.

75. What is the use of Extension Manager in Joomla?
Extension Manager is used to extend the functionality of Joomla website.

76. How we can turn on /off caching in Joomla?
To disable and enable caching in Joomla, follow these steps:-
• Login to the backend of Joomla
• Go to System, then Global Configuration and Open System Tab
• You will get the Cache settings
• Set it according to your preference
• Save and close

77. List the server requirements for Joomla 3.x?
• Greater than PHP 5.3 or equal
• Greater than MySQL 5.1 or equal
• Greater than Apache 2.0 or equal

78. What is the use Official Support Forum in Joomla?
Official Support Forum helps in supporting the exchange of ideas and views officially in Joomla.

79. What is the use of Documentation Wiki in Joomla?
The Documentation Wiki is used for formatting the content of articles, cross linking pages and creating the documentation of Wiki template by themselves.

80. What is Joomla Translations?
Joomla translations help in translation of language in Joomla core files. It helps in documentation and screens along with other task to meet the need of diverse language community.

81. What is Community Portal?
Community Portal helps in bringing Joomla news from all over the world at one place.

82. What is the use of Module Class Suffix in Breadcrumb Module?
Setting this parameter causes Joomla to either add a new CSS class or modify the existing CSS class for the div element for this specific module.

83. What is Feed Display Module in Joomla?
Feed Display Module is used to show the RSS News Feeds from a website. It is a way to provide user with the updated content from other resources.

84. What is Footer Module?
Footer displays the information of the Joomla license and the copyright of the website.

85. What is Latest News Module?
Latest News Module is used to display the most recent published article in a list.

86. What is Search Module?
Search Module is used to display a search box, where the user types a particular name to search the website.

87. What is Random Image Module?
Random Image Module is used to display the images randomly from the selected directory.

88. What is Who’s Online Module?
This module helps to display the user’s information that is accessing the website.

89. What is Syndicate Module?
Syndicate module helps in creating an RSS Feed link for the page. It allows creating a Newsfeed by user for the current page.

90. What is the use of Path to Log Folder under system setting?
It gives a path to store the logs by Joomla. This path is automatically set up on Joomla installation and should not be changed.

91. What is the use of Joomla Media Settings?
Joomla Media Settings help to configure the global media files options such like file format, MIME specifications, upload of files, size of files etc.

92. What is Media Manager?
It is the tool for managing the media files and folder in which you can easily upload, organize and manage your media files into your article editor tool.

93. What is Language Manager?
The Joomla language manager option is used to set the Native Title, Language Code, SEF Prefix, and Image Prefixes of the installed or to be installed languages.

94. What is the use of Mass Emailing in Joomla?
Mass Mail is used for sending emails to the group of registered users. Users can be selected based on groups.

95. What is the use of Debug system section under debug setting?
It is a debugging system of Joomla which provides debug information by setting it to “Yes”. It provides some various forms such as diagnostic information, language translations and SQL errors.

96. What is Web Link Manager?
The link resource is provided for user of the site and can be sorted into categories.

97. What is Menu Manager?
It allows creating menus and menu items and can be managed subsequently. You can put menu in any style and in multiple places.

98. What is Rss?
It stands for Really Simple Indication which syndicates your site contents and RSS files can be automatically updated.

99. What is Content Manager?
It allows managing the content using WYSIWYG editor to create or edit the content in a very simple way.

100. What web services does Joomla Support?
Joomla supports Remote Procedure Calls and XML-RPC services

Sign-up for our email newsletter and get free job alerts, current affairs and GK updates regularly.
Subscribe Here (or)

Leave a Reply

Your email address will not be published. Required fields are marked *

8 − two =

Popup Dialog Box Powered By :
  • RSS
  • Facebook
  • Google+
  • Twitter